What is a personal injury claim and how does one begin?

On Behalf of | Sep 10, 2018 | Car Accidents, Firm News, Personal Injury |

A personal injury claim for damages is an important tool for victims who have been injured by a careless driver. A personal injury claim for damages provides an option for victims of negligent drivers to pursue compensation for the physical, financial and emotional damages suffered in a car or other traumatic accident.

It is important to note that after suffering an injury in a car accident or other type of traumatic accident, victims should seek necessary medical care and treatment. In addition to caring for your health following a car accident, it is also important to keep records of the medical care and treatment you receive. Detailed medical records will help down the road to establish the amount of damages the victim has suffered and explain the future medical care and treatment they may need.

Additionally, following a car accident, it is important to collect evidence related to the accident, including photographs; obtain any available witness statements; obtain a police report; and take careful notes concerning everything that happened. Once the victim has made the decision to file a claim for damages, they will need to file their lawsuit and provide notice of the lawsuit to the negligent party. There are time limits associated with filing a personal injury claim for damages so it is important for victims to be familiar with what those are and what the process for filing a claim is.

A personal injury claim for damages is important to understand, as it protects victims and can help them with medical expenses, lost wages and pain and suffering damages. Victims can better protect themselves following a car accident by understand the legal resources and remedies available to them, including a personal injury claim for damages.
